Responsibilities of a Year 3 Teacher
- Lead the pastoral care of pupils beginning their transition into Key Stage 2
- Plan and deliver engaging, well-structured lessons aligned with the lower KS2 curriculum
- Support pupils in strengthening literacy and numeracy foundations
- Introduce more complex concepts in maths, reading comprehension and independent writing
- Track pupil progress, identify learning needs and implement effective support strategies
- Communicate regularly with parents regarding academic and pastoral development
- Create a positive, encouraging classroom environment that promotes confidence and curiosity
